Number System With A Base Of 2 - Unlike The Number Systems Most Of Us Use That Have Bases Of 10 (Decimal Numbers) - 12 (Measurement In Feet And Inches) - And 60 (Time). Binary Numbers Are Preferred For Computers For Precision And Economy. An Electronic Circuit That Can Detect The Difference Between Two States (On-off - 0-1) Is Easier And More Inexpensive To Build Than One That Could Detect The Differences Among Ten States (0-9).
